当前位置: 首页 > news >正文

西安制作公司网站的公司邯郸市三建建筑公司网址

西安制作公司网站的公司,邯郸市三建建筑公司网址,wordpress图片域名,即将倒闭的设计院C中的vector和C语言中的数组在很多方面都有所不同#xff0c;以下是它们之间的一些主要区别#xff1a; 大小可变性#xff1a; vector是C标准模板库#xff08;STL#xff09;提供的动态数组容器#xff0c;它的大小可以动态增长或减少。这意味着你可以在运行时添加或删… C中的vector和C语言中的数组在很多方面都有所不同以下是它们之间的一些主要区别 大小可变性 vector是C标准模板库STL提供的动态数组容器它的大小可以动态增长或减少。这意味着你可以在运行时添加或删除元素而不需要事先知道数组的大小。C语言中的数组的大小是固定的一旦定义后就无法改变。如果需要更改大小你需要手动重新分配内存并复制数据。 内存管理 vector会自动处理内存的分配和释放。当元素数量增加时vector会动态地分配更多的内存来容纳更多的元素而当元素被移除时它会自动释放内存。在C语言中你需要手动管理内存。你需要使用malloc()、calloc()或realloc()来分配内存并使用free()来释放内存。 元素访问 vector提供了方便的成员函数和操作符来访问和操作元素如at()、operator[]等。C语言中的数组可以使用下标操作符[]来访问元素但没有内置的边界检查。这意味着你需要自己确保不要访问超出数组边界的内存否则可能导致未定义的行为或内存错误。 传递和返回 vector可以直接作为函数参数传递和返回而不需要显式地传递数组大小。在C语言中如果要传递数组给函数通常需要额外传递数组大小作为参数因为数组本身会退化为指向其第一个元素的指针。 vector提供了更高级、更安全和更方便的动态数组管理功能而C语言中的数组更底层需要更多手动管理和注意事项。 本片完
http://www.zqtcl.cn/news/232782/

相关文章:

  • 泉州模板建站定制成都网页设计培训机构
  • 个人微信公共号可以做微网站么免费产品推广软件
  • 建设银行瓶窑支行网站阿里域名官网
  • 宿迁网站seo中原建设信息网 网站
  • 地方网站域名用全拼建设银行网站怎么登录密码忘了怎么办
  • win7 iis7 添加网站秦皇岛 网站建设
  • 手机模板网站模板下载工具Wordpress elgg
  • 宠物网站建设的目的wordpress图创
  • 网站首页图片怎么更换浙江省建设政务网站
  • 宁波有哪家公司做网站的京东联盟网站建设电脑版
  • 电商网站业务流程网站制作在哪找
  • 学校网站建设教程加盟网站制作费用
  • fqapps网站建设少儿戏曲知识 网站建设
  • 产品网站建设框架wordpress用户名密码加密方式
  • 入侵dedecms网站管理员密码青岛seo整站优化公司
  • 小网站备案南宁网站建设排名
  • 西安免费做网站wordpress 使用方法
  • 企业营销的意义优化核心系列网站
  • 微信网站设计一起做网站17广州
  • 重庆网络推广网站如何制作app演示视频
  • 网站logo是指手机上做app的软件
  • 做母婴育儿类网站好做seo排名吗深圳网站. 方维网络
  • 小型装修公司店面装修windows优化大师会员
  • php服装商城网站建设wordpress主题去除友情链接
  • 北京网站设计公司sx成都柚米科技15福建众利建设工程网站
  • 深圳大型网站建设服务公司wordpress后台为什么这么慢
  • 信用网站建设工作简报青岛的建筑公司
  • 网站怎么做文件上传灯饰 东莞网站建设
  • 建设电子商务网站的规划书电子商务平台网站模板
  • 桂林网站建设 腾云安康养老院收费